  • @Caba-Rojo
    @Caba-Rojo 6 หลายเดือนก่อน +3

    ROG:
    Out of House Traveler
    VRR
    High End prop eGPU’s
    Better Sound
    Lighter / Easier in Hand
    Lego:
    In House Traveler
    Bigger Screen w/wider color spectrum
    Hall Effect joysticks
    Taller Resolution (for 4:3 games)
    Upcoming accessory suite
    CAN output to third-party eGPU’s via USB 4 (think G1, OneXGPU)
